Computer vision for detecting field-evolved lepidopteran resistance to Bt maize.

Summary

A new computer vision algorithm accurately measures insect damage to crops, improving detection of pest resistance to Bacillus thuringiensis (Bt) toxins. This technology enhances crop stewardship and reduces unnecessary insecticide use.
